John Henry Price, Sr., aged 99, passed into eternity, welcomed by Jesus, his Savior, late in the morning, on Tuesday, October 28, 2025. He was born on November 16, 1925, the fourth of six children to Glenn and Rubell Price in Rosinville, SC. John grew up in a Christian family and was influenced in his early years to consider becoming an overseas missionary. World War II slightly interrupted those influences when, at the age of 17, John enlisted with the U. S. Navy. He served as a Hospital Corpsman and was in active service until his honorable discharge in March 1946. John went on to attend Columbia Bible College for one year and Bob Jones University, earning a BA in English, Bible and Teacher Training. He met and married fellow Bob Jones University student, Doris Mae Cooper, on June 2, 1950, and enjoyed over 65 years of marriage with her and welcomed six children into their family. John and his family joined SIM, a missions organization, and moved to Nigeria, Africa, where he spent the bulk of his 21 years of service in education-related roles and responsibilities. The family returned to the U.S. in 1973 and John filled the role of Secretary at the SIM USA office for the next seven years. His next stage in life was filled with various pastoral roles in the Southern Methodist Church, both as the Church Extension Director in Orangeburg, SC and as a Senior Pastor in Monroe, LA. The Prices concluded their ministry career in 1996 and moved to the SIM Retirement Village in Sebring. Even in his retirement, John continued in ministry by serving as a Chaplain with the Florida Department of Corrections for eight years.
John was preceded in death by his parents, two brothers, two sisters, his wife, Doris, and a grandson, Joshua Pifer. He is survived by his sister, Mamie Mills, his six children: John (Neema) Price, Jr., Jean (Jim) Cail, Lila (Dean) Spencer, Alice (Joel) Pifer, Donald (Debbie) Price, Philip (Dawn) Price, as well as 22 grandchildren and 36 great-grandchildren.
